改性环氧丙烯酸酯胶粘剂预聚体增韧改性研究

摘    要:采用聚乙二醇改性环氧E-44树脂,改性后E-44与α-甲基丙烯酸进行酯化反应,得到改性环氧丙烯酸酯预聚体。由单因素实验确定反应条件如下:第一步反应温度为90℃,第二步反应温度为95℃,聚乙二醇与环氧树脂的物质的量比为0.20:1,催化剂四丁基溴化铵用量为2.0%,阻聚剂对羟基苯甲醚用量为0.05%。红外光谱分析表明,改性环氧丙烯酸酯预聚体合成成功。由改性预聚体配制的胶粘剂粘度减小,拉伸剪切强度可达5.95MPa,180°剥离强度也有所提高。

Study on Toughening and Modification of Prepolymer of Modified Epoxy Acrylates

Abstract:Prepolymer of modified epoxy acrylates was synthesized through epoxy resin E-44 modification by polyethylene glycol and then esterification with a-methaerylic acid. Through single factor experiment, the opti- mal synthetic conditions were obtained as follows.the first step reaction temperature was 90 ℃ ,the second re- action temperature was 95 ℃, the molar ratio of polyethylene glycol to epoxy resin was 0. 20 : 1, the catalyst (tetrabutyl ammonium bromide) dosage was 2.0 %, the polymerization inhibitor(p-hydroxyanisole) dosage was 0.05 ;. Infrared spectroscopic analysis proved the success of modification. After modification, viscosity of adhe- sive declined,shear strength reached 5.95 MPa,180; peel strength improved.
